What is Double Glazing?
Before we dive into the complexities of Best Double Glazing glazing warranties, let's quickly summarize what double glazing is. Double glazing consists of two panes of glass separated by a space filled with argon gas or a vacuum. This design develops an insulating barrier that assists maintain indoor temperatures, reducing the requirement for heating and cooling.

When it comes to double glazing service warranties, there are normally three main types to consider:
Warranty TypeCoverageNormal DurationMaker WarrantyCovers flaws in products and craftsmanship.5 to 20 yearsInstaller WarrantyCovers installation concerns and workmanship from the installation business.1 to 10 yearsGlass Breakage WarrantySafeguards versus the expenses associated with glass damage.1 to 10 years (differs)1. Manufacturer Warranty
This warranty covers defects in the manufacturing of the Energy-Saving Windows themselves. Manufacturers normally guarantee that their items will be devoid of flaws in products and craftsmanship for a specified duration. Common protection locations consist of:
Seal failure: This happens when the insulating gas gets away from in between the panes.Frame problems: Problems with the Custom Window Installation frame, including warping and deterioration.Glass problems: Includes scratches, cracks, and staining.2. Installer Warranty
The installer warranty covers the aspects of the installation process, guaranteeing that the windows are set up correctly. This is important due to the fact that incorrect installation can lead to issues that might void the producer's warranty. Key protection points include:
Improper sealing: If the windows are not sealed correctly, it might result in air and water leakages.Misalignment: Windows that are not installed appropriately may impact their functionality and performance.Labour problems: Covers errors made during the installation that result in extra repairs.3. Glass Breakage Warranty
This warranty offers coverage for costs associated with glass damage, whether from unexpected damage or external impacts. The specifics of this warranty can vary substantially in between companies, so it's vital to inspect the details thoroughly.

What is normally covered under a double glazing warranty?
Most double glazing warranties cover problems in materials and workmanship, seal failure, and frame issues. Inspect the specific terms for the producer and installers.
2. How can I guarantee my warranty stays legitimate?
To maintain your warranty, guarantee you comply with any maintenance requirements stipulated within the warranty document and report any issues promptly.
3. Is a longer warranty always better?
Not always. A longer warranty can indicate self-confidence in the item's quality, but it is likewise crucial to assess the track record of the producer and installer.
4. What should I do if my warranty claim is rejected?
If a warranty claim is rejected, get in touch with the producer or installer for clarification. It may be helpful to intensify the matter or consult legal recommendations if you think the denial is baseless.
5. Can I purchase extra warranty protection?
Some manufacturers and installers may use prolonged warranty options for an extra charge. This can provide extra assurance, specifically for high-traffic or high-impact areas.
